Therapeutic RANK inhibition reduces breast cancer recurrence

Researchers at the Institute of Biomedical Research of Bellvitge (IDIBELL), led by Dr. Eva Gonzalez-Suarez, have shown that pharmacological and genetic inhibition of signaling pathway RANK / RANKL leads to a significant reduction in recurrences and metastases in breast cancer in a mouse animal model. Dr. Conxi Lázaro is awarded the Theodor Schwann Prize for his research in the field of neurofibromatosis

Dr. Conxi Lázaro, director of the Molecular Diagnostic Unit of the ICO-IDIBELL Hereditary Cancer Program, has received the prestigious Theodor Schwann prize awarded by the European Association of Neurofibromatosis.
